Toliss Shows the New Features of the Airbus A330-900 for X-Plane

X-Plane add-on developer ToLiss Simulation Solutions provided a new look at its upcoming Airbus A330-900 focusing on some of the new features it will include.

In the new Facebook post, we get to see the new HUD, including a video showcasing it in action. The HUD can be set to display realistic or perfect data on the ISCS (Interactive Simulation Control System). Incidentally, all the features mentioned here can be activated and deactivated in the ISCS.

You can check the video out on its own Facebook Post (it can’t be embedded, so you’ll have to click on it), showing a landing at night.

ATSAW (Airborne Traffic Situation Awareness) provides a real-time picture of surrounding traffic. You can also select a specific aircraft to display additional information about it.

X-Plane Toliss A330 (2)

The ATSAW (Airborne Traffic Situation Awareness) integrates RMP, ACP, and transponder into a single unit, helping select radio frequencies more simply.

ROW/ROPS (Runway Overrun Warning & Protection system) triggers a go-around if the approach, while stabilized, will lead to the inability to stop before the end of the runway. After the touchdown, it warns the pilot if the same situation arises. On take-off, a warning is delivered if the thrust selected is different from the one inputted in the FMS.

X-Plane 12 is currently available for PC. The Airbus A330-900 by Toliss will be released on October 19, 2024. You can also check out plenty of screenshots released recently by the developer a few days ago.
